German stocks rose sharply on Monday, with the DAX gaining 348.52 points or 1.36% to 25,979.30, as easing geopolitical tensions and a surge in the manufacturing PMI boosted sentiment. Brent crude futures fell more than 4.5% from the previous close, easing inflation concerns, after U.S. President Donald Trump cancelled planned military strikes on Iran and said there is a good chance of progress in talks. S&P Global confirmed Germany's Manufacturing PMI at 52.2 in July, the highest in four months, up from 50.3 in June. SAP moved up 4.3%, while Siemens Healthineers, Adidas, Deutsche Telekom, Airbus, and Mercedes-Benz climbed 3% to 4%. Stabilus rallied 4.5% after reporting a sharp rise in third-quarter net profit helped by a one-off gain from the sale of subsidiaries.
